Observation details
Adult. Regular, nearly resident Trepassey individual. Has unusually heavily streaked head. Could be Greenland race photos. Streaking this heavy on a Glaucous Gull is unusual on a Newfoundland Glaucous Gull especially this late in the season. The head streaking was significantly heavier in mid winter. The bird is 5 years old having first being seen as a one year old bird over the summer in Trepassey area. It has spent most of each year since in the Trepassey area. Personally I suspect this bird is a vagrant/lost GLGU from Greenland or somewhere else in Europe where GLGU have more heavily streaked heads than NF winter GLGUs.
